Ideal for spectrographs and other compact systems using small detector arrays, UV Transmission Gratings are a simplistic means of dispersing light for fixed grating applications in the 250 – 450nm wavelength range. As incident light strikes the UV Transmission Gratings’ coarse groove spacing, it is dispersed on the opposite side of the grating at a fixed angle. As groove spacing increases, the diffraction angle decreases. UV Transmission Gratings are relatively polarization insensitive and are fairly insensitive to alignment errors.
Handling Gratings: Gratings require special handling, making them prone to fingerprints and aerosols. Gratings should only be handled by the edges. Before attempting to clean a grating, please contact us.
